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/330.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 大黄蜂问:哪些版本可以被认为是稳定的?_Java_Jms_Hornetq - Fatal编程技术网

Java 大黄蜂问:哪些版本可以被认为是稳定的?

Java 大黄蜂问:哪些版本可以被认为是稳定的?,java,jms,hornetq,Java,Jms,Hornetq,我读过《大黄蜂Q》的常见问题,但找不到任何相关内容。 我使用的是Hornetq2.2.5,它包含一个bug(是的,只有一个;)。根据这篇文章,它是从2.2.7.1开始固定的。 在主下载页面上,可用的最新版本是2.2.5.Final。我并不害怕自己编写一个新版本,但我能认为它稳定吗? 我会说是的,因为这是一个小的版本更新,但我想要一些其他的意见。谢谢。嗯,经过进一步研究,我可以说是的,它是稳定的。 特别是JBoss EAP 5.1.2包包括HornetQ版本2.2.10.GA。 我想知道为什么在H

我读过《大黄蜂Q》的常见问题,但找不到任何相关内容。 我使用的是Hornetq2.2.5,它包含一个bug(是的,只有一个;)。根据这篇文章,它是从2.2.7.1开始固定的。 在主下载页面上,可用的最新版本是2.2.5.Final。我并不害怕自己编写一个新版本,但我能认为它稳定吗?
我会说是的,因为这是一个小的版本更新,但我想要一些其他的意见。谢谢。

嗯,经过进一步研究,我可以说是的,它是稳定的。 特别是JBoss EAP 5.1.2包包括HornetQ版本2.2.10.GA。
我想知道为什么在HornetQ下载页面上没有直接链接。

好吧,经过进一步研究,我可以说是的,它是稳定的。 特别是JBoss EAP 5.1.2包包括HornetQ版本2.2.10.GA。
我想知道为什么在HornetQ下载页面上没有直接链接。

这个答案以2.3.X分支为例。让我们跳过他们的下载页面,直接转到工件:

您可以看到,2.3.X经历了Alpha、Beta和CR阶段,最终达到了2.3.0.Final社区版。这是开放源码世界中大多数人最终会使用的,并且您会发现可以轻松下载

这也是非付费客户打算使用的最后一个版本(在典型的JBoss发布周期中,请参阅)。现在,从商业角度来看,2.3.0.Final将再次被视为Alpha。JBoss AS/EAP FAQ中的一个类比可能也适用于此:“第一个EAP阶段Alpha与社区最终版本具有同等或更好的质量[…]我们不建议在生产中使用它”(可能是一个过于苛刻的判断,但无论如何。)

在2.3.0.Final之后,他们修复了更多的bug(2.3.1.Final,2.3.2.Final,…),直到他们获得商业生产版本(他们将其捆绑到其他商业产品中)。因此,您应该使用最新的.Final进行生产(对于2.3.X分支,它是2.3.13.Final

你必须为2.3.13.期末考试付费吗?据我所知,你不需要付费。(除与其他产品捆绑销售外,HornetQ在AFAICT市场上也不可用。)

如何获得2.3.13.Final?您可能找不到包装精美的RPM甚至zip文件。相反,您需要从公共Maven repos(或从源代码构建)获取JAR


你需要JBoss版本控制和产品命名的研究生学位才能使用他们的产品吗?也许:)-我没有,所以如果我没有理解野兽的巨大复杂性,请提前道歉。但我真的希望HornetQ开发人员能够轻松地获得他们产品的稳定版本,并且知道这就是我们正在使用的。这是一个很好的产品(可能是该产品中功能最全的),有一本优秀的手册,但对下载页面和常见问题的快速判断可能会让一些人转而关注竞争项目。

这个答案以2.3.X分支为例。让我们跳过他们的下载页面,直接转到工件:

您可以看到,2.3.X经历了Alpha、Beta和CR阶段,最终达到了2.3.0.Final社区版。这是开放源码世界中大多数人最终会使用的,并且您会发现可以轻松下载

这也是非付费客户打算使用的最后一个版本(在典型的JBoss发布周期中,请参阅)。现在,从商业角度来看,2.3.0.Final将再次被视为Alpha。JBoss AS/EAP FAQ中的一个类比可能也适用于此:“第一个EAP阶段Alpha与社区最终版本具有同等或更好的质量[…]我们不建议在生产中使用它”(可能是一个过于苛刻的判断,但无论如何。)

在2.3.0.Final之后,他们修复了更多的bug(2.3.1.Final,2.3.2.Final,…),直到他们获得商业生产版本(他们将其捆绑到其他商业产品中)。因此,您应该使用最新的.Final进行生产(对于2.3.X分支,它是2.3.13.Final

你必须为2.3.13.期末考试付费吗?据我所知,你不需要付费。(除与其他产品捆绑销售外,HornetQ在AFAICT市场上也不可用。)

如何获得2.3.13.Final?您可能找不到包装精美的RPM甚至zip文件。相反,您需要从公共Maven repos(或从源代码构建)获取JAR

你需要JBoss版本控制和产品命名的研究生学位才能使用他们的产品吗?也许:)-我没有,所以如果我没有理解野兽的巨大复杂性,请提前道歉。但我真的希望HornetQ开发人员能够轻松地获得他们产品的稳定版本,并且知道这就是我们正在使用的。这是一个很好的产品(也许是这一系列产品中功能最全的),有一本优秀的手册,但对下载页面和常见问题的快速判断可能会让一些人转而关注竞争项目